CMS DRESS CODE


DRESS CODE - How students dress affects their behavior.  Appropriate school dress is the responsibility of every student and parent.  A school is a place for learning. Clothing standards for all students are:

  1. The clothing promotes cleanliness.

  2. The clothing promotes modesty, modesty will be defined at Clinton Middle School as the following dress requirements:  

  1. Shorts, skirts may be no shorter than the length of a dollar bill from the knee.

  2. Running shorts are not allowed at school.

  3. Tops shoulder width must be as wide as the width of a dollar bill (no off the shoulder shirts, tank tops, spaghetti straps, or shirts which do not cover the shoulder blade on the back will be allowed).

  4. Cleavage is never appropriate at school and will not be tolerated.

  5. Shirts must meet the waist of pants.

  6. Pants must be worn at the waist of pants (i.e., sagging is not permitted).

  7. No house shoes or pajama pants allowed unless it is a designated spirit day. Spirit day clothing must meet all other dress requirements.

  1. The clothing is not disruptive to the learning process at Clinton Middle School.

  2. Clothing may not promote illegal substances, vulgarity, cults, Satanism, or other inappropriate imprints including the Confederate flag.

  3. “Gang” related clothing is not permitted at Clinton Middle School or school events. This includes but is not limited to bandanas, bands, colors, or gang paraphernalia.

  4. All caps, hats, beanies, and gloves are not allowed to be worn in the building.  These items may be confiscated and held until the end of the school year.

*Students in violation of any of the above dress code guidelines may be sent home to change and charged with an unexcused absence.
